摘要
TIFY蛋白是植物特异性转录因子,在植物生长、发育和基因调控中具有重要作用。尽管部分菜豆TIFY基因被鉴定与研究,但从基因组水平剖析TIFY基因家族的研究未见报道。结合基因组和转录组学数据,本研究系统剖析了菜豆TIFY基因家族的序列、选择、表达及进化特征。结果显示:18个PvTIFY基因散落分布在9条染色体上,共线性鉴定出6对片段重复基因和1对串联重复基因,同时这些基因被分为6大类群;序列分析表明,菜豆TIFY基因有12种基因结构模式,但有5种保守基序组成模式,这说明保守基序模式更保守;选择压力检测显示,同源基因对均受到负选择作用,显示较高的保守性;表达分析揭示了菜豆TIFY家族基因具有多样化的表达模式,其中同源基因对表达模式发生趋异现象。这些结果为深入研究菜豆TIFY蛋白的生理功能提供了参考。
TIFY proteins are the plant-specific transcription factors and play an important role in plant growth,development and gene regulation.Although some TIFY genes were characterized and studied in common bean,no studies on the PvTIFY gene family were reported at the genomic level.The sequence,selection,expression and evolution of the TIFY gene family were systematically analyzed based on genomic and transcriptomic data.The results were showed that 18 PvTIFY genes are scattered on nine chromosomes.Microsyntenic analysis revealed six pairs of fragment duplicates and one pair of tandem duplicates,and at the same time,these PvTIFY genes are divided into six major groups.Sequence analysis showed that the PvTIFY genes have 12 gene structure patterns,but the encoding proteins of which have 5 conserved motif composition patterns,suggesting that the motif pattern is much more conserved than gene structure.Selection pressure test showed that homologous gene pairs were negatively selected,showing highly conservation.Expression analysis revealed that the PvTIFY genes display a variety of expression patterns,and most of homologous gene pairs have divergent expression patterns.These results provide a reference for further study on the physiological function of TIFY protein in common bean.
